非营养性吸吮联合母亲声音刺激干预在早产儿喂养中的应用效果研究

摘要

目的 探讨非营养吸吮联合母亲声音刺激应用在早产儿喂养中的应用效果.方法随机抽样选取2016年7月至2017年7月在贵州医科大雪附属医院新生儿科收治的早产儿129例.按照随机数字表法分为3组:NNS组、对照组(常规护理组)、NNS+MSS组各43例.NNS组给予非营养性吸吮,对照组给予新生儿一般常规治疗和护理,NNS+MSS组给予非营养性吸吮联合母亲声音刺激.观察3组早产儿喂养过渡时间情况、初次进食持续时间情况、住院天数情况.结果 NNS+MSS组的喂养过渡时间、初次喂养持续时间、住院天数3项得分分别为(8.60 ± 1.24)d、(8.16 ± 1.74) min、(13.26 ± 1.84)d,NNS组分别为(12.09 ± 2.10)d、(4.72 ± 1.45)min、(14.70 ± 1.79)d,对照组分别为(17.70 ± 2.30)d、(2.28 ± 1.39)min、(19.81 ± 4.17)d,3组比较差异有统计雪意义(F=242.085、159.313、63.856,均P<0.01);结论 非营养性吸吮联合母亲声音刺激能够促进早产儿尽早从鼻饲喂养向完全经口喂养转换,减少中间转换时间,加快喂养进程,缩短住院天数.%Objective to explore the effect of non nutritive sucking combined with maternal voice stimulation on feeding process in premature infants. Methods A total of 129 premature infants admitted to the neonatal department of a tertiary hospital from July 2016 to July 2017 were randomly selected. According to the random number table method, there were 3 groups: NNS group, control group (routine nursing group), and NNS+MSS group, each with 43 cases. Non-nutritive sucking was given in the NNS group, general routine treatment and nursing in the control group, and non-nutritive sucking combined with mother's voice stimulation in the NNS+MSS group. The duration of feeding, initial feeding and hospitalization were observed in 3 groups. Results NNS+MSS group feeding transition time, the first feeding duration, hospitalization days three points respectively (8.60 ± 1.24)d, (8.16 ± 1.74)min, (13.26 ± 1.84)d, and NNS group respectively (12.09 ± 2.10) d, (4.72±1.45) min, (14.70±1.79) d, the control group, respectively (17.70±2.30) d (2.28 ± 1.39) min (19.81± 4.17) d. The differences between the three groups were statistically significant (F=242.085, 159.313, 63.856, all P<0.05). Conclusions Non nutritive sucking combined with mother sound stimulation can promote early feeding from nasal feeding to complete transoral feeding as soon as possible, reduce intermediate conversion time, accelerate feeding process and shorten hospitalization time.
